## ProctorFlow Queue — Release Manager Notes

Welcome! Every release of the ProctorFlow exam queue gets smoke-tested against the Invigilate staging cluster before you cut the tag. The smoke suite drains a fake exam session through the queue, so expect it to take about four minutes. It authenticates to the internal Invigilate scheduler with a key that release managers share among themselves. For staging runs, use the following key:

gateway credential: qvz11-4NwDe4XF1V4

- [ ] Step 7: Archive cold storage buckets (Glacierline tier). Confirm both ceremony witnesses are present, verify bucket manifests match the Oxbow ledger, then seal the archive key shares. Plugin authors may observe but not handle shares. Once sealed, the archive index itself is encrypted and can only be reopened with the passphrase below.

vault phrase of badup-hahig = tamael-aldael-kelmir-istael-fenok-istwyn-tamius-jorath-oliion

Ticket: FIELD-2281 — Expired credentials blocking offline sync

For the weekly sync: the Heronpath field-survey app's offline mode stopped reconciling on Monday because the cached sync token expired while crews were out of coverage. Surveys queued locally are intact, but uploads fail silently until re-auth. We've extended token lifetime to 30 days and reissued credentials. The replacement key for the internal sync service follows.

service key, fafog-fahaf: vxb3-x55

Build provenance for the Thornquay checkout load tests: yes, we actually pin everything. The load generator (Stampede) is built from a tagged commit, and the scenario configs are hashed into the artifact manifest, so you can verify the exact traffic profile used in any run. No mutable latest tags anywhere in the chain. Each signed run report ends with a short provenance token, and the one for the current report is below.

session token of tajef-bageg = htk21_5d90d574934f3ccae6437